Home
last modified time | relevance | path

Searched refs:ci (Results 1 – 19 of 19) sorted by relevance

/net/sched/
Dact_connmark.c105 struct tcf_connmark_info *ci; in tcf_connmark_init() local
132 ci = to_connmark(*a); in tcf_connmark_init()
138 ci->net = net; in tcf_connmark_init()
139 ci->zone = parm->zone; in tcf_connmark_init()
143 ci = to_connmark(*a); in tcf_connmark_init()
155 spin_lock_bh(&ci->tcf_lock); in tcf_connmark_init()
157 ci->zone = parm->zone; in tcf_connmark_init()
158 spin_unlock_bh(&ci->tcf_lock); in tcf_connmark_init()
174 struct tcf_connmark_info *ci = to_connmark(a); in tcf_connmark_dump() local
176 .index = ci->tcf_index, in tcf_connmark_dump()
[all …]
Dact_ctinfo.c166 struct tcf_ctinfo *ci; in tcf_ctinfo_init() local
235 ci = to_ctinfo(*a); in tcf_ctinfo_init()
259 spin_lock_bh(&ci->tcf_lock); in tcf_ctinfo_init()
261 cp_new = rcu_replace_pointer(ci->params, cp_new, in tcf_ctinfo_init()
262 lockdep_is_held(&ci->tcf_lock)); in tcf_ctinfo_init()
263 spin_unlock_bh(&ci->tcf_lock); in tcf_ctinfo_init()
283 struct tcf_ctinfo *ci = to_ctinfo(a); in tcf_ctinfo_dump() local
285 .index = ci->tcf_index, in tcf_ctinfo_dump()
286 .refcnt = refcount_read(&ci->tcf_refcnt) - ref, in tcf_ctinfo_dump()
287 .bindcnt = atomic_read(&ci->tcf_bindcnt) - bind, in tcf_ctinfo_dump()
[all …]
/net/bluetooth/cmtp/
Dcore.c76 static void __cmtp_copy_session(struct cmtp_session *session, struct cmtp_conninfo *ci) in __cmtp_copy_session() argument
79 memset(ci, 0, sizeof(*ci)); in __cmtp_copy_session()
80 bacpy(&ci->bdaddr, &session->bdaddr); in __cmtp_copy_session()
82 ci->flags = session->flags & valid_flags; in __cmtp_copy_session()
83 ci->state = session->state; in __cmtp_copy_session()
85 ci->num = session->num; in __cmtp_copy_session()
462 struct cmtp_conninfo ci; in cmtp_get_connlist() local
464 __cmtp_copy_session(session, &ci); in cmtp_get_connlist()
466 if (copy_to_user(req->ci, &ci, sizeof(ci))) { in cmtp_get_connlist()
474 req->ci++; in cmtp_get_connlist()
[all …]
Dsock.c71 struct cmtp_conninfo ci; in do_cmtp_sock_ioctl() local
126 if (copy_from_user(&ci, argp, sizeof(ci))) in do_cmtp_sock_ioctl()
129 err = cmtp_get_conninfo(&ci); in do_cmtp_sock_ioctl()
130 if (!err && copy_to_user(argp, &ci, sizeof(ci))) in do_cmtp_sock_ioctl()
157 cl.ci = compat_ptr(uci); in cmtp_sock_compat_ioctl()
Dcmtp.h58 struct cmtp_conninfo __user *ci; member
64 int cmtp_get_conninfo(struct cmtp_conninfo *ci);
/net/bluetooth/bnep/
Dcore.c674 static void __bnep_copy_ci(struct bnep_conninfo *ci, struct bnep_session *s) in __bnep_copy_ci() argument
678 memset(ci, 0, sizeof(*ci)); in __bnep_copy_ci()
679 memcpy(ci->dst, s->eh.h_source, ETH_ALEN); in __bnep_copy_ci()
680 strcpy(ci->device, s->dev->name); in __bnep_copy_ci()
681 ci->flags = s->flags & valid_flags; in __bnep_copy_ci()
682 ci->state = s->state; in __bnep_copy_ci()
683 ci->role = s->role; in __bnep_copy_ci()
694 struct bnep_conninfo ci; in bnep_get_connlist() local
696 __bnep_copy_ci(&ci, s); in bnep_get_connlist()
698 if (copy_to_user(req->ci, &ci, sizeof(ci))) { in bnep_get_connlist()
[all …]
Dsock.c58 struct bnep_conninfo ci; in do_bnep_sock_ioctl() local
115 if (copy_from_user(&ci, argp, sizeof(ci))) in do_bnep_sock_ioctl()
118 err = bnep_get_conninfo(&ci); in do_bnep_sock_ioctl()
119 if (!err && copy_to_user(argp, &ci, sizeof(ci))) in do_bnep_sock_ioctl()
155 cl.ci = compat_ptr(uci); in bnep_sock_compat_ioctl()
Dbnep.h131 struct bnep_conninfo __user *ci; member
142 int bnep_get_conninfo(struct bnep_conninfo *ci);
/net/bluetooth/hidp/
Dcore.c72 static void hidp_copy_session(struct hidp_session *session, struct hidp_conninfo *ci) in hidp_copy_session() argument
75 memset(ci, 0, sizeof(*ci)); in hidp_copy_session()
76 bacpy(&ci->bdaddr, &session->bdaddr); in hidp_copy_session()
78 ci->flags = session->flags & valid_flags; in hidp_copy_session()
79 ci->state = BT_CONNECTED; in hidp_copy_session()
82 ci->vendor = session->input->id.vendor; in hidp_copy_session()
83 ci->product = session->input->id.product; in hidp_copy_session()
84 ci->version = session->input->id.version; in hidp_copy_session()
86 strscpy(ci->name, session->input->name, 128); in hidp_copy_session()
88 strscpy(ci->name, "HID Boot Device", 128); in hidp_copy_session()
[all …]
Dsock.c55 struct hidp_conninfo ci; in do_hidp_sock_ioctl() local
113 if (copy_from_user(&ci, argp, sizeof(ci))) in do_hidp_sock_ioctl()
116 err = hidp_get_conninfo(&ci); in do_hidp_sock_ioctl()
117 if (!err && copy_to_user(argp, &ci, sizeof(ci))) in do_hidp_sock_ioctl()
161 cl.ci = compat_ptr(uci); in hidp_sock_compat_ioctl()
Dhidp.h122 struct hidp_conninfo __user *ci; member
128 int hidp_get_conninfo(struct hidp_conninfo *ci);
/net/rxrpc/
Drxkad.c43 struct crypto_sync_skcipher *ci);
61 struct crypto_skcipher *ci; in rxkad_preparse_server_key() local
68 ci = crypto_alloc_skcipher("pcbc(des)", 0, CRYPTO_ALG_ASYNC); in rxkad_preparse_server_key()
69 if (IS_ERR(ci)) { in rxkad_preparse_server_key()
70 _leave(" = %ld", PTR_ERR(ci)); in rxkad_preparse_server_key()
71 return PTR_ERR(ci); in rxkad_preparse_server_key()
74 if (crypto_skcipher_setkey(ci, prep->data, 8) < 0) in rxkad_preparse_server_key()
77 prep->payload.data[0] = ci; in rxkad_preparse_server_key()
103 struct crypto_sync_skcipher *ci; in rxkad_init_connection_security() local
110 ci = crypto_alloc_sync_skcipher("pcbc(fcrypt)", 0, 0); in rxkad_init_connection_security()
[all …]
/net/6lowpan/
Diphc.c616 struct lowpan_iphc_ctx *ci; in lowpan_header_decompress() local
661 ci = lowpan_iphc_ctx_get_by_id(dev, LOWPAN_IPHC_CID_SCI(cid)); in lowpan_header_decompress()
662 if (!ci) { in lowpan_header_decompress()
668 err = lowpan_iphc_uncompress_ctx_addr(skb, dev, ci, &hdr.saddr, in lowpan_header_decompress()
689 ci = lowpan_iphc_ctx_get_by_id(dev, LOWPAN_IPHC_CID_DCI(cid)); in lowpan_header_decompress()
690 if (!ci) { in lowpan_header_decompress()
697 err = lowpan_uncompress_multicast_ctx_daddr(skb, ci, in lowpan_header_decompress()
713 ci = lowpan_iphc_ctx_get_by_id(dev, LOWPAN_IPHC_CID_DCI(cid)); in lowpan_header_decompress()
714 if (!ci) { in lowpan_header_decompress()
721 err = lowpan_iphc_uncompress_ctx_addr(skb, dev, ci, &hdr.daddr, in lowpan_header_decompress()
/net/bluetooth/
Dhci_conn.c2553 struct hci_conn_info *ci; in hci_get_conn_list() local
2560 if (!req.conn_num || req.conn_num > (PAGE_SIZE * 2) / sizeof(*ci)) in hci_get_conn_list()
2563 size = sizeof(req) + req.conn_num * sizeof(*ci); in hci_get_conn_list()
2575 ci = cl->conn_info; in hci_get_conn_list()
2579 bacpy(&(ci + n)->bdaddr, &c->dst); in hci_get_conn_list()
2580 (ci + n)->handle = c->handle; in hci_get_conn_list()
2581 (ci + n)->type = c->type; in hci_get_conn_list()
2582 (ci + n)->out = c->out; in hci_get_conn_list()
2583 (ci + n)->state = c->state; in hci_get_conn_list()
2584 (ci + n)->link_mode = get_link_mode(c); in hci_get_conn_list()
[all …]
/net/ipv4/
Ddevinet.c895 struct ifa_cacheinfo *ci; in rtm_to_ifaddr() local
897 ci = nla_data(tb[IFA_CACHEINFO]); in rtm_to_ifaddr()
898 if (!ci->ifa_valid || ci->ifa_prefered > ci->ifa_valid) { in rtm_to_ifaddr()
902 *pvalid_lft = ci->ifa_valid; in rtm_to_ifaddr()
903 *pprefered_lft = ci->ifa_prefered; in rtm_to_ifaddr()
1643 struct ifa_cacheinfo ci; in put_cacheinfo() local
1645 ci.cstamp = cstamp_delta(cstamp); in put_cacheinfo()
1646 ci.tstamp = cstamp_delta(tstamp); in put_cacheinfo()
1647 ci.ifa_prefered = preferred; in put_cacheinfo()
1648 ci.ifa_valid = valid; in put_cacheinfo()
[all …]
/net/bridge/
Dbr_fdb.c105 struct nda_cacheinfo ci; in fdb_fill_info() local
133 ci.ndm_used = jiffies_to_clock_t(now - fdb->used); in fdb_fill_info()
134 ci.ndm_confirmed = 0; in fdb_fill_info()
135 ci.ndm_updated = jiffies_to_clock_t(now - fdb->updated); in fdb_fill_info()
136 ci.ndm_refcnt = 0; in fdb_fill_info()
137 if (nla_put(skb, NDA_CACHEINFO, sizeof(ci), &ci)) in fdb_fill_info()
/net/ipv6/
Daddrconf.c4939 struct ifa_cacheinfo *ci; in inet6_rtm_newaddr() local
4941 ci = nla_data(tb[IFA_CACHEINFO]); in inet6_rtm_newaddr()
4942 cfg.valid_lft = ci->ifa_valid; in inet6_rtm_newaddr()
4943 cfg.preferred_lft = ci->ifa_prefered; in inet6_rtm_newaddr()
5009 struct ifa_cacheinfo ci; in put_cacheinfo() local
5011 ci.cstamp = cstamp_delta(cstamp); in put_cacheinfo()
5012 ci.tstamp = cstamp_delta(tstamp); in put_cacheinfo()
5013 ci.ifa_prefered = preferred; in put_cacheinfo()
5014 ci.ifa_valid = valid; in put_cacheinfo()
5016 return nla_put(skb, IFA_CACHEINFO, sizeof(ci), &ci); in put_cacheinfo()
[all …]
/net/core/
Dneighbour.c2557 struct nda_cacheinfo ci; in neigh_fill_info() local
2591 ci.ndm_used = jiffies_to_clock_t(now - neigh->used); in neigh_fill_info()
2592 ci.ndm_confirmed = jiffies_to_clock_t(now - neigh->confirmed); in neigh_fill_info()
2593 ci.ndm_updated = jiffies_to_clock_t(now - neigh->updated); in neigh_fill_info()
2594 ci.ndm_refcnt = refcount_read(&neigh->refcnt) - 1; in neigh_fill_info()
2598 nla_put(skb, NDA_CACHEINFO, sizeof(ci), &ci)) in neigh_fill_info()
Drtnetlink.c834 struct rta_cacheinfo ci = { in rtnl_put_cacheinfo() local
840 ci.rta_lastuse = jiffies_delta_to_clock_t(jiffies - dst->lastuse); in rtnl_put_cacheinfo()
841 ci.rta_used = dst->__use; in rtnl_put_cacheinfo()
842 ci.rta_clntref = atomic_read(&dst->__refcnt); in rtnl_put_cacheinfo()
849 ci.rta_expires = (expires > 0) ? clock : -clock; in rtnl_put_cacheinfo()
851 return nla_put(skb, RTA_CACHEINFO, sizeof(ci), &ci); in rtnl_put_cacheinfo()